Question by TheNardCake: how come this will not go into windows movie maker?
Well i finally figured out how to get my ipod camera videos to my computer (nano 5th gen.). So now i have a whole seperate file where i can view them whenever (only certian ones) even when my ipod is not plugged in. So im trying to make a movie in Windows Movie Maker with these videos but whenever i drag it in it just says something like this is not the right kind of file you have to download and install some codec and if you already did shut down and restart windows movie maker. What in the world does that mean?!?!?!? I already shut it off and reopended it many times it still won’t work what do i do and what is this codec thing i am supposed to download?

Best answer:

Answer by Ben
Apple uses a format to encode the videos called H.264, the same format used by YouTube and many other websites. However, companies have to pay to be able to use H.264. Microsoft didn’t license the ability to play those videos until Windows 7 so unless you can find a codec (a program that tells Windows how to play those files), Windows Movie Maker can’t understand those videos.
